What Is a Remainder in Math?

In math, a remainder is the amount left over when one number is divided by another but the result isn’t a whole number. It helps represent incomplete divisions and tells us what’s “left out.”

Definition of a Remainder

So, what is the definition of remainder in math? Here’s a simple explanation:

When you divide 10 by 3, you get 3 as the quotient, but 1 is left over. That “1” is the remainder. In mathematical terms:

Dividend ÷ Divisor = Quotient with Remainder

Example:
10 ÷ 3 = 3 R1

This means 3 fits into 10 three times, and 1 is left.

You’ll see this format often in long division problems and even while using a calculator with remainders for division.

Parts of a Division Problem

Before diving deeper, let’s review the basic parts of a division equation:

  • Dividend: The number to be divided.
  • Divisor: The number you divide by.
  • Quotient: The result (how many times the divisor fits).
  • Remainder: The leftover amount.

Example:
74 ÷ 7 = 10 R4

Here,
Dividend = 74, Divisor = 7, Quotient = 10, Remainder = 4

Understanding what is the quotient and the remainder is key to solving division problems accurately.

Real-Life Examples of Remainders

Let’s bring math into the real world.

Example 1: Sharing Chocolates

Imagine you have 10 chocolates and 3 friends. You give each friend 3 chocolates. That totals 9 chocolates. You’re left with 1. That leftover chocolate is the remainder.

Example 2: Packing Apples

If you pack 46 apples into boxes of 8, how many full boxes can you make?
46 ÷ 8 = 5 R6

You’ll have 5 full boxes and 6 apples left over.

How to Find the Remainder

There are two main ways:

1. Manual Method

Use long division:
Example:
52 ÷ 8 = 6 R4

You divide 52 by 8:

  • 8 fits into 52 six times (8 x 6 = 48)
  • Subtract 48 from 52 = 4

So, the remainder is 4

Remainder in Long Division

Sometimes, you’re asked to show your work using long division.

Let’s try:
6338 ÷ 43

  • 43 goes into 6338 about 147 times
  • Multiply: 147 × 43 = 6321
  • Subtract: 6338 – 6321 = 17

Remainder = 17

Long division shows the process, and with tools like a long division with remainder calculator, you can check your answers easily.

Remainder Theorem (Bonus Concept)

Ever heard of the Remainder Theorem? It’s used in algebra to find remainders when dividing polynomials.

Here’s a simplified version:
If a polynomial f(x) is divided by (x – a), the remainder is f(a).

Remainders in Synthetic Division

Synthetic division is a shortcut used in algebra. If the remainder is zero, the divisor divides the polynomial evenly.

Properties of Remainders

Knowing how remainders behave is helpful:

  • The remainder is always smaller than the divisor
  • If the remainder is zero, the division is exact
  • Remainders are whole numbers
  • Remainders are useful in modulo arithmetic (coding and encryption)

These remaining math rules help you avoid mistakes during exams or coding.

How to Represent Remainders

There are different formats to show a remainder:

  • Integer + Remainder: 7 ÷ 3 = 2 R1
  • Decimal: 7 ÷ 3 = 2.33
  • Fraction: 7 ÷ 3 = 2 1/3
